Raleigh Train Third Birthday Photography – Choo Choo!

We got special permission to use this super cute train location for this little one’s third birthday portraits. He was sooooooo excited to see the trains and had so much fun bouncing around to all the different spots. His mama is a stylist so she definitely dressed him so adorable and picked the perfect background for this session. I’ve been photographing this little one since he was six months old, and he is always so full of smiles and so much fun to photograph! His mama also had his portraits displayed at his party – a super cute photo display with several from this session and also a huge print behind the party table which was sooooo cute! Did you bring any props to the session? Of course! His favorite train, a train conductor hat and a bandanna.

Any advice to others planning to have portraits taken? Have fun! Specially dealing with little ones, they can sense the stress and will be less cooperative if you are all over them.
